Lucius drove back to the hospital where Liliana was admitted.

Grant rushed over the second he saw Lucius approach.

But when he realized Lucius had returned alone, without the renowned surgeon, his face darkened instantly.

"Lucius, where is Dr. Dyson?"

Grant's face twisted with deep dissatisfaction over Lucius's failure to secure the doctor for his daughter.

Lucius made a quick phone call. A moment later, a foreign man dressed in a white coat walked in. He was quite young, with short brown hair, glasses, and a broad, muscular build.

This was clearly not Dr. Dyson.

Lucius made the introductions. "Grant, this is Dr. Julian Herbort. He is a senior specialist in orthopedic surgery and sports medicine with an international reputation for treating athletic trauma. Although he's younger, he has served as the lead surgeon for national athletes. For Liliana's condition, his expertise is just as formidable as Dr. Dyson's."

Before Lucius could finish, Grant suddenly raised his hand and swung hard.

Slap!

A vicious backhand struck Lucius directly across the face.

"What did you promise me and Lily?" Grant roared. "We told you her condition specifically requires Dr. Dyson, or she'll face amputation! And you didn't even take it seriously! You dragged in some second-rate amateur to brush us off! I never thought you were this kind of man. You've completely disappointed me!"

Lucius narrowed his eyes, his brow furrowing as he absorbed the stinging pain across his cheek.

He never expected Grant to have the audacity to hit him.
